Output e653ffed83e9c35b2813db7a8110e0b2073d27a0a0c2049050e3c54f6b11fdf6:1

value
43244
script pubkey
OP_0 OP_PUSHBYTES_20 681341c70b7653c1bdee690bfde52453f485ca2a
address
tb1qdqf5r3ctwefur00wdy9lmefy206gtj325nhk05
transaction
e653ffed83e9c35b2813db7a8110e0b2073d27a0a0c2049050e3c54f6b11fdf6
confirmations
30873
spent
true